Product Description

The Clear Sip Samsung DA29-00003G refrigerator water filter reduces bad taste and odor as well as chlorine, dirt, sediment, rust and other particles. It helps reduce lime scale buildup and offers added protection for your ice maker. The Clear Sip Samsung DA29-00003G refrigerator water filter will last around 300 gallons or six months. You should replace this refrigerator water filter at the first sign of pressure drop, or if your water has a bad taste or odor.

Clear Sip Samsung DA29-00003G specifications:

Flow Rate: 0.5 gpm / 1.9 lpm

Operating Temperature: 33° - 100° F (0.6° - 38° C)

Filter Life: 6 months or 300 gallons (1.136 liters)

Minimum Operating Pressure: 30 psi (207 kPa)

Maximum Operating Pressure: 100 psi (689 kPa)
